add media truncate

This commit is contained in:
willifan 2024-06-03 13:47:23 +02:00
parent d66cebb05d
commit 79d371e6ae

View file

@ -6,6 +6,11 @@
(defwidget time [] (defwidget time []
(box
:class "barbox"
:space-evenly false
:spacing 3
(space)
(eventbox (eventbox
:onclick `` :onclick ``
:class "smallBox" :class "smallBox"
@ -13,7 +18,8 @@
:height 20 :height 20
:width 70 :width 70
(label (label
:text "${formattime(EWW_TIME, "%H:%M:%S")}"))) :text "${formattime(EWW_TIME, "%H:%M:%S")}"))
(space)))
;; center ;; center
@ -100,24 +106,23 @@
(defwidget media [] (defwidget media []
(box (box
:class "barbox"
:visible {media.status == "Playing" ? true : false} :visible {media.status == "Playing" ? true : false}
:spacing 3 :spacing 3
:space-evenly false :space-evenly false
:halign "end" :halign "end"
:valign "center" :valign "center"
:height 20 :height 30
(seperator) (space)
(box (box
:class "smallBox" :class "smallBox"
:height 20 :height 20
:valign "center" :valign "center"
:space-evenly false
(space)
(label (label
:text {media.name} :text {media.name}
:tooltip {media.name} :tooltip {media.name}
:limit-width 40) :truncate true))
(space)))) (space)))
(defwidget processing [] (defwidget processing []
(eventbox (eventbox
@ -193,14 +198,12 @@
(defwidget start [] (defwidget start []
(box (box
:class "barbox"
:orientation "h" :orientation "h"
:space-evenly false :space-evenly false
:height 30 :height 30
:halign "start" :halign "start"
:valign "center" :valign "center"
:spacing 3 :spacing 3
(space)
(time) (time)
(media) (media)
(space))) (space)))